// REINDEX_BATCH_CAP limits docs per shard pass in the Tallowfield
// nightly search reindex. Raising it starves the ingest queue;
// lowering it overruns the maintenance window. 5000 is the tested
// sweet spot. Change only with a soak run. Verified against the
// build noted below.

session token of bawif-hahog = htk6_ac5981

## Deployment

ReceiptWren, our donation-receipt mailer, deploys from the `stable` branch via the Quillgate pipeline. Before promoting a build, confirm the template bundle version matches what the Harbrook finance team signed off on, since receipts are legally sensitive. Run the dry-run mailer against the sandbox donor list and inspect at least three rendered PDFs. Rollbacks must restore both the binary and the template bundle together; mismatched pairs produce blank totals. The environment expects the following configuration values at startup.

settings of tawif-tafog:
[oliox]
port = 7000
team = pelius
host = oliox.plorvaforge.corp
region = upper-2
access_code = ac_48b9f0
timeout_ms = 3000

QUARTERLY PLANNING NOTE — Finance Team

Churn in the Bramblewick pilot programme reached 11% this quarter, above the 7% forecast. Exit interviews cite onboarding friction rather than pricing. Retention credits issued so far total a modest sum and remain within the pilot budget. Marta Osgood's team will revise the onboarding flow before the next cohort. No change to revenue guidance is proposed at this stage. The confidential planning note is appended below for finance eyes only.

internal memo for hafog-hadug: The pricing group signed off on a budget of $16.1 million for Project Gorir. The renewal with Oliionax Systems closes at $14.1 million a year, 46 percent above the last contract.